The ingredients needed to make Ginger soy salmon:
  1. Take 2 salmon fillets
  2. Get 2 tsp avocado oil
  3. Take 2 tbsp soy sauce
  4. Prepare 1 1/2 tbsp grated ginger (the pre done jars are great)
  5. Get 2 tsp maple syrup (optional)

Instructions to make Ginger soy salmon:
  1. Get a medium sized pan with a lid and spray down with your oil of choice
  2. Lay the salmon fillets in the pan and put one tsp of avocado oil on each of the fillets. Rub very gently to spread it over the whole fillet as best as you can.
  3. Mix the soy sauce, ginger and maple syrup together until ginger looks broken up and take a small spoonful at a time and coat the salmon.
  4. Try to use up the ginger bits on the salmon so any reserved liquid can be used for the steam liquid. The less water you can add to this, the better.
  5. Steam for approximately 10 mins. The time will depend on how thick your fillets are but watch for the salmon to shrink to gauge cook time. Take a peek if needed.
